Transaction 89084645faf36a6eceb638883...

Transaction id
89084645faf36a6eceb638883e33282c73b73c9cab2ebf2bab33b4787b22ce80 copied to clipboard error copying to clipboard
Block
19217
Timestamp
Total value out
532,15398890
Version
1
Transaction fee
0,00000000
Output